Buena Vida Continuing Care and Rehabilitation Center in Brooklyn, NY is a well-established 240-bed residential health care facility catering to elderly patients in need of physical and occupational therapy, audiology, speech therapy, ophthalmology, and dentistry services.
The center's bilingual staff offers a range of amenities, including restaurant-style dining rooms serving healthy food tailored to meet dietary standards for recovering patients, along with continuing care and hospice services for those in need.
